              iii. Rheumatic Heart Disease

              Among various heart diseases, rheumatic heart disease is one of them. This disease

              is frequently found in the children between 3 to 15 years of age. In the beginning
              of this disease, tonsillitis and pharyngitis may be observed. The patient may suffer
              from fever after one to four weeks of frequent pain in the throat. This is known
              as rheumatic fever. At this time, along with the fever, the patient may feel joint
              pain and swelling as well. This disease is caused by bacteria called Beta hemolytic
              streptococcus. Group - 'A' more than 50% of the children suffering from rheumatic
              fever have problems in their valves in the heart so that this disease is called rheumatic

              heart disease. The early symptoms of this disease include painful throat, loss of voice,
              fever, etc. We have to consult for treatment immediately after these symptoms.

              Summary


              A disease is a body condition in which a person becomes unable to carry out daily
              activities, feels unhealthy, and the body organs and systems cannot function properly.
              The diseases are of two types: communicable and non-communicable.

              To keep ourselves away from the diseases, we have to pay special attention to
              our food habits, physical exercise, personal and environmental cleanliness,
              healthy behaviour, vaccination, etc.

              The disease that can communicate to an individual through different means is
              called a communicable disease. For example, meningitis, encephalitis, hepatitis,
              HIV/ AIDS, etc.
              The disease that emerges from the body itself due to various causes is known as
              non-communicable disease.
